How long does it take to implement OpenEduCat for a K-12 school?

Most K-12 schools are fully operational within 4-6 weeks. This includes data migration, staff training, and parent portal setup. Our implementation team handles the heavy lifting so your teachers can focus on instruction during the transition.

Can teachers and staff be trained quickly, or is it complex?

OpenEduCat is built on an intuitive interface that most teachers learn within a single training session. We provide role-specific training, teachers see only the tools they need (gradebook, attendance), while office staff access administrative functions. Average onboarding time is under 2 hours per staff member.

Does OpenEduCat integrate with our existing student information systems?

Yes. OpenEduCat can import data from most existing SIS platforms through CSV import, API integrations, or custom migration scripts. We support data migration from PowerSchool, Infinite Campus, and other common K-12 systems. Your historical data comes with you.

What does the parent portal actually show parents?

Parents get secure access to their child's real-time attendance records, current grades and assignment scores, upcoming events, teacher communications, and downloadable report cards. They can view this from any device, desktop or mobile. You control exactly what information is visible.

Does OpenEduCat support Danielson teacher evaluation framework?

OpenEduCat supports teacher evaluation workflows that can be configured to align with the Danielson Framework for Teaching or Marzano model. Administrators can record observation notes, document performance ratings by domain, and maintain a full evaluation history for each teacher. This gives principals an organized, auditable record for instructional coaching conversations and HR documentation.

Can I track PBIS behavior interventions?

Yes. OpenEduCat includes behavior tracking that allows staff to log incidents, interventions, and outcomes in a structured format. You can track recognition events alongside disciplinary referrals, giving you a complete PBIS picture. Reports show behavior trends by student, classroom, grade level, and time of day, helping leadership identify patterns early.

How does OpenEduCat support RTI/MTSS workflows?

OpenEduCat allows schools to document student support tiers within the student record. Staff can log intervention plans, track progress-monitoring data, and schedule review meetings. Principals get visibility into how many students are in Tier 2 and Tier 3 supports across the school, making it easier to allocate resources and demonstrate compliance with RTI/MTSS requirements during audits.
